A treasure hunt is one of the most exciting activities a parent can set up for his or her kids. The purpose of the game is to follow a trail of clues around the house or backyard, where each hidden note includes a clue leading to the next note on the trail. After solving 3-5 and even more clues, the participants, usually in small groups of 2-5 kids, will eventually find their "treasure" which could be anything from Easter eggs, to candy, to a birthday cake or a birthday present.

Another way you can play Treasure hunt, is as a family past-time, with just one or two kids working together to find clues around the house. This is a great idea if your child's birthday comes up and you are looking for an original way to give them their birthday presents.
